Branch Coverage

blib/lib/WebService/Pandora/Method.pm
Criterion Covered Total %
branch 4 30 13.3


line true false branch
21 1 0 unless $class
54 1 1 if defined $error
66 1 0 unless (defined $self->{'name'} and defined $self->{'host'})
75 0 0 if (defined $self->{'userAuthToken'})
80 0 0 if (defined $self->{'syncTime'})
92 0 0 if ($self->{'encrypt'})
97 0 0 unless (defined $json_data)
105 0 0 $self->{'ssl'} ? :
117 0 0 if (defined $self->{'userAuthToken'}) { }
0 0 elsif (defined $self->{'partnerAuthToken'}) { }
129 0 0 if (defined $self->{'partnerId'})
135 0 0 if (defined $self->{'userId'})
153 0 0 unless ($response->is_success)
166 0 0 if ($json_data->{'stat'} ne 'ok')
173 0 0 if defined $json_data->{'result'}